Henley Executive is seeking a Channel Account Manager to join the sales team and manage a portfolio of SME partner accounts in the communications space.

The role focuses on relationship-building, retention, and opportunistic upselling.

The package includes a base salary of £30,000–£40,000 with a target of £30k–£40k in commission, and a comprehensive benefits package.

You will drive account growth and ensure client satisfaction while meeting deadlines.
